Hi, my partner was checking his bank account for an Amazon refund when he noticed he’d had Amazon prime membership taken twice from his bank account this month …. He questioned this with them and they says they had only took one payment he had to contact his bank…. He then contacted his bank to find since 2017 he’s had most months 2 payments taken out of his bank through his debit card…. Amazon are refusing this and the bank are saying they can’t do anything about this….. please can you advise on what he can do thank you

    Anyone else in the family have their own Amazon acc that may have his card listed in?
    As Prime will default to payment method if another card expires.

    Maybe go back to Amazon & ask the question is this relating to any known family emails address. They can not say which acc, but they can & will say yes, giving you a idea if it is a known to you account.
